Document Description
The Project consists of stabilizing a 75-foot section of eroded stream bank within Kinder Morgan Energy Partners pipeline right-0f-way. The 10-inch pipeline was taken out of service in 2009. Kinder Morgan Energy Partners still possess the pipeline right-of-way. In 2011, the majority of the exposed pipeline was removed and the ends were capped. The pipeline parallels the east bank of Arcade Creek at the location of the erosion site. The Project will result in 0.02 acre of permanent impacts to waters of the United States.
